Defining sponge cake can get a little — forgive us — spongy. Never up for debate is the centrality of egg, sugar, and flour. It's also, as made clear by the name, meant to be light and airy.
While it is believed the first actual birthday cake was made in Germany in the Middle Ages, our modern idea of cakes as round things decorated with icing comes from 17th century Europe.
